MIDIUMISOLID FW18 Takes a Painterly Approach to Maximalism
Rich textures, unique textiles and billowy silhouettes.
Following the brand’s Spring/Summer 2018 drop, MIDIUMISOLID returns for Fall/Winter 2018. Produced by Mother’s Industry director Nobuaki Sasano and TAAKK designer Morikawa Tsubuseno, the collection centers around bold outerwear and slouchy trousers, with statement pieces elevating a variety of otherwise low key looks. Bold patterns, shiny metallics and oversized denim appear throughout the range, with muted basic items allowing the louder layering piece to take center stage. Furry knitwear adds textural intrigue to the collection, joined by crinkled wool, plastic-abetted fleece jacquard knit patterns and iridescent houndstooth. A whiff of sportswear surfaces here and there, with painted running sneakers and wide track jackets accenting quiet cardigans and unfettered white shirts.
Expect the new goods to hit store shelves in Japan within a few weeks.
